Resultados 1 a 10 de 57

Threaded View

  1. #1
    Developer C++ Alankoba's Avatar
    Data de Ingresso
    Mar 2018
    Posts
    23
    Thanks Thanks Given 
    0
    Thanks Thanks Received 
    3
    Thanked in
    2 Posts
    Mencionado
    3 Post(s)
    País
    Brazil

    Launcher Alankoba 2019 [Auto update] [Sem false-positives] [Clean]

    Olá pessoal, segue a atualização do meu launcher que fiz em 2007. Decidi fazer este atualização após muitos pedidos no Facebook/e-mail. Como alguns já devem saber este projeto foi baseado no launcher do navossoc (Rafael do MucaBrasil), portanto não se trata de uma cópia ou modificação não autorizada. O código fonte da base deste projeto está disponível no Github desde 2017, e em breve pretendo liberar as melhorias implementadas na versão 2019. A gente até tenta sair do Muonline, mas ele não sai da gente Vida longa ao MU!


    Funcionalidades originais

    Informação
    ⦁ Verificação CRC dos arquivos (algoritmo extremamente rápido).
    ⦁ Compactação no formato RAR (utiliza a lib unrar.dll).
    ⦁ Configurações do Muonline como usuário, ajustes de som e resolução.
    ⦁ Compatível com Windows XP/Vista/7/8/8.1/10 (Até o update November testado).
    ⦁ Utiliza somente componentes nativos do Windows.
    ⦁ Atualização do próprio launcher.
    ⦁ Não precisa de .NET Framework nem de outras dependências.
    ⦁ Leve e livre de "false-positives".



    Principais alterações da versão 2019

    Informação
    ⦁ Adaptações para funcionar sem problemas no Windows 8/Windows 10.
    ⦁ Suporte total ao Windows UAC.
    ⦁ Otimização no algoritmo de verificação dos arquivos e outras melhorias internas para garantir melhor confiabilidade das atualizações.
    ⦁ Gerador do arquivo de configurações do Launcher.
    ⦁ Configuração simples da Skin do Launcher em Data/Launcher (Há uma Skin exemplo no download, basta habilitar em config.cfg).
    ⦁ Suporte a novas resoluções e ao seletor de linguagem do Muonline (via configuração).
    ⦁ Opção para salvar o IP do Main no registro do Windows (via configuração).
    ⦁ Browser interno utilizará a versão mais recente do IE instalada (Frameworks CSS compatíveis).
    ⦁ Links do Browser que abrem uma nova janela serão abertos no navegador padrão do usuário.
    ⦁ Configuração dos textos do Launcher através do arquivo config.cfg (possibilidade de usar em outros idiomas).



    Como usar?

    Informação
    1. Abra o gerador da configuração e preencha suas informações.
    2. Copie o arquivo de configuração launcher.cfg e cole ao lado do jogar.exe
    3. Copie seu Patch para a pasta update do gerador de atualizações.
    4. Abra o gerador de atualizações, clique em listar e logo em seguida em Gerar.
    5. Suba os arquivos da pasta update na URL que você configurou no gerador do Launcher.



    Dicas
    Informação
    1. Na pasta do gerador de atualizações contem uma pasta chamada "clear", utilize-a para manter uma versão descompactada do seu Patch, pois dessa forma você pode sempre atualizar os arquivos ali e logo em seguida copiar para a pasta "update".
    2. Você pode remover a borda do Browser que abre no Launcher usando CSS.
    3. Muita gente deixa de baixar seu servidor por que o instalador é muito grande, então faça uma estrategia que deixa um pouco desse download no launcher, igual muitas empresas fazem. Desta forma você tira uma barreira de entrada para novos players.



    Dúvidas frequentes
    Informação

    Posso copiar o jogar.exe, atualiza.exe, unrar.dll e launcher.cfg na própria pasta update?

    Resposta: Sim pode! Isso garante que ninguém vai modificar nem mesmo esses arquivos, alem disso você também pode fazer isso para atualizar o próprio launcher.

    Posso deixar o jogo completo dentro da pasta update?
    Resposta: Sim pode! Mas note que a verificação dos arquivos ficará um pouco mais lenta, de qualquer forma o launcher está muito bem otimizado para verificar milhares de arquivos.

    Posso mudar o nome do jogar.exe?
    Resposta: Não! Infelizmente ainda não fiz as adaptações necessárias para permitir isso, mas pretendo fazer em breve, por isso fique de olho nas próximas versões do Launcher.

    Diz que não tem atualizações disponíveis o que fiz de errado?
    Resposta: Não se esqueça da barra "/" no final da URL na hora de configurar.

    Funciona em qualquer hospedagem?
    Resposta: Sim! Desde que você possa subir arquivos no formato .RAR.

    Esta atualização também será de código aberto?
    Resposta: Por enquanto não! Mas daqui algum tempo disponibilizarei no Github assim como o projeto antigo.

    Não consigo mudar a cor da Skin o que fiz de errado?
    Resposta: A cor está no formato RGA Integer.


    O que ainda esta por vir?
    Informação
    1. Novas melhorias internas na verificação dos arquivos.
    2. Downloads em paralelo para baixar mais rápido.
    3. Configuração da Skin do Launcher pelo próprio gerador do Launcher.
    5. Suporte a conexão com o Main em IPV6 (se ipv4 não estiver disponível então usar uma ROTA tunelada para IPV6).
    6. Suporte a calculo de rota (ping test).
    7. AutoPlay ao concluir as atualizações.



    E então pessoal... Vocês tem alguma dica do que pode ser implementado no Launcher? Lembrando que este projeto é 100% gratuito e somente para Muonline. Se alguém quiser contribuir com uma nova Skin seria de grande ajuda.

    Imagens do Launcher original e de uma Skin exemplo

    [Somente membros podem ver os links. ][Somente membros podem ver os links. ][Somente membros podem ver os links. ][Somente membros podem ver os links. ]

    Download

    [Somente membros podem ver os links. ]

    Pessoal, quem puder faça os links mirror para que este arquivo se perpetue na comunidade.
    Se alguém quiser contribuir com um novo design será de grande valor. É só me avisar.


    Divulgação
    Canal no Youtube pra falar sobre Muonline, quem puder se inscrever e dar uma força...
    Ela joga o Global e sempre fala bastante sobre as novidades nas versões mais recentes.

    [Somente membros podem ver os links. ]



    Valeu!! Qualquer coisa estamos ai.
    Last edited by Alankoba; 19/12/2019 at 05:23 PM.

  2. The Following 2 Users Say Thank You to Alankoba For This Useful Post:


Tags para este Tópico

Permissões de Postagem

  • Você não pode iniciar novos tópicos
  • You may not post Resposta(s)
  • Você não pode enviar anexos
  • Você não pode editar suas mensagens
  •  
Sobre nós
Somos uma comunidade em atividade a 8 anos que aborda assuntos relacionados a games em geral, principalmente games MMORPG. e que busca sempre ajudar os membros através de conteúdos, tutoriais e suporte...
Nossos anunciantes
Hinetworks
VelozHost
InovHost
Rede Sociais